Clarence Alexander ObituaryObituary published on Legacy.com by Coleman's Family Mortuary - Woodville on Mar. 7, 2026.Clarence Alexander, 42, of Jasper, Texas departed this life Thursday March 5, 2026.Clarence Alexander was born on July 10,1983 in Galveston, Texas. He was the beloved son of Patsy Keys and Elder Lynson Alexander and Reverend Patrick Haskell. Clarence grew up in Jasper, where he met the Lord at an early age, joined the church, and was baptized. Clarence was loved by everyone, and he loved everyone in return. After graduating from Jasper High School, he continued his education at Houston Community College and also attended Texas Southern University.Clarence had a true passion for life, even when his health began to fail. Through it all, his hope and trust remained in God. He was a wonderful son to his mother and father and the greatest big brother to his younger brother. Throughout his life, Clarence worked in many occupations where he was able to serve and help others.
